I'm not sure if a similar topic has been started in months past, so forgive me if this is not a new topic. I've been wondering what the best legal streaming service, or combination of services, would be to watch UEFA, CONMEBOL, and WC qualifiers and WC finals matches for a fan in the US. I originally planned on FUBO TV but then saw that Fox Soccer Match Pass became available for my platform (Amazon Fire TV/Fire Stick). Unfortunately, after being quite happy with FSMP for the first week or so, Fox announced that this app would no longer carry WC finals matches as was previously advertised. Worse than that, the app simply stopped launching on all my Fire TV devices for the last four days. After force-stopping the app on all devices, trying to launch it again, un-installing and re-installing the app, contacting FSMP and getting a woefully useless response (and no response at all to follow up contacts), I have given up and demanded a full refund.

I don't know what the result will be, but I want to start looking for an alternative streaming service now and avoid any possible temptation to stay with FSMP. Any recommendations are greatly appreciated.

I've heard FUBO.TV has the best sports selection, although I haven't checked on the WC stuff.

Personally I use youtube.tv, and I know you can add on fox soccer plus which should give you everything. Should be available on all devices. I think total cost would be $50/month with the FSP addon although that also includes basically a full cable channel lineup.
